Role Overview:
We are seeking an experienced and proactive Civils Site Agent to oversee HDD Landfall & ducting installation works in the North of Scotland.
The ideal candidate will have a solid background in site management within a heavy Civils environment and be confident in coordinating teams, ensuring health & safety compliance, and delivering projects on time and within budget.
Key Responsibilities:
- Lead and manage site operations from inception to completion.
- Liaise with clients, engineers, subcontractors, and suppliers.
- Ensure all works are carried out in line with company policies, procedures, and health & safety regulations.
- Monitor project progress, ensuring timelines, budgets, and quality standards are met.
- Compile reports, RAMS, and site documentation.
- Manage site teams and provide clear instructions to achieve targets.
- Proven experience as a Site Agent or Senior Site Engineer on civil engineering projects.
- Degree or HNC/HND in Civil Engineering or related field (desirable).
- Strong knowledge of earthworks, drainage, roads, and utilities.
- SMSTS, CSCS, and First Aid certifications.
- Excellent leadership, communication, and problem-solving skills.
- Full UK driving licence.
